There is a new player on the block if ya didn't already know. Well what you want to do is doable for sure. you can do it time based. Time based will get you out of first gear. Lets say you want to split your shot up 75/75. So you figure 75 outa the hole then you can ramp in second 75hp by time and have it coming in later and fully in second gear if you like. Or set second 50% to come on after your 60' time, or 600 feet or what you want/need. There are so many controllers and ways to do this that it gets a little confusing. Our controller is going to be time based progressive, which I think is a little better than rpm based, cause rpm based you have to have everythin in on each gear, compared to getting full hit beased on time. Im currious how they work too, do you need another set of solenoids and nozzles for the second "step"? From what I know about electroinc stuff a solenoid eigther fires, or it doesnt, they arent adjustable to open half way, they are open, or closed. Thanks for the info.
#6
They pulse the solenoids, basically turning them on and off very (very very) fast. In doing so you end up with a nice power curve. I can't comment on wiring other manufactures controllers, but The Advantage is pretty easy. There are 4 wires. One goes to the ground wire on your solenoids. Second goes to your arming switch. Third is a ground, and the fourth is a "trigger wire". The Trigger Wire will activate the unit (when supplying a ground). Lots of different ways to activate, if using a window switch in your set up the window switch would trigger The Advantage on (with a relay). So installation is pretty simple.
Any progressive controller is going to have to be dialed in for the environment that it's being used in. If you wanted to bypass The Advantage you could set your start % to 60, end % to 100 and build time to 0.1. The solenoids will go through 1 quick progression (off | on | off | full on) and you'll be at full power. So you will have .1 of a second delay before 100% full power.
